Factors to Consider When Choosing Oled Tv Deals Black Friday
Choosing an OLED TV during Black Friday sales requires understanding several key factors that influence your viewing experience and value. While price discounts are tempting, it’s important to consider how size, features, and compatibility fit your specific setup. Avoid common pitfalls like overspending on unnecessary features or selecting a size that doesn’t suit your space. Our guide covers critical considerations to help you make a smart purchase that balances quality, features, and budget.Size and Viewing Distance
Size is often the most obvious factor, but it must be paired with your viewing distance for optimal results. Larger screens provide immersive experiences, especially in open living rooms, but may overwhelm smaller spaces. To get the most from OLED picture quality, sit at a distance where the pixels blend seamlessly—generally, about 1.5 to 2.5 times the screen diagonal. Choosing a size too small might underwhelm, while too large can cause discomfort or require repositioning furniture.
Picture Quality and Processing Features
OLED panels are prized for their perfect black levels and contrast. Beyond panel quality, look for models with advanced processing like AI upscaling, Dolby Vision support, and high peak brightness. These features enhance HDR content and ensure vibrant, detailed images across different content types. Beware of models that cut corners on processing; they may display less dynamic or duller images despite their OLED screens.
Smart Features and Ecosystem Compatibility
Smart TV capabilities are essential for streaming and integrated voice assistants. Choose a model that supports your preferred ecosystem—Google TV, webOS, Tizen, or Android TV—so you can access apps easily and control your smart home devices. Some models come with better app support, faster interfaces, and more regular updates, which extend the lifespan and usability of your TV. Be cautious of models with limited app support or slow navigation.
Budget and Long-term Value
While Black Friday deals often offer significant discounts, it’s wise to consider long-term value. Cheaper models may lack key features like higher peak brightness or better processing, limiting your viewing experience. Conversely, investing in a slightly more expensive model can provide future-proofing with better HDR performance, wider viewing angles, and more durable build quality. Avoid impulsive buys; compare discounted prices with regular MSRPs to gauge true savings.
Brand Reputation and Customer Support
Brand reputation influences reliability and customer support quality. LG and Sony are known for their exceptional OLED panel quality, while Samsung offers larger sizes and robust smart features. Check warranty policies and support services, especially for higher-priced models, as OLED panels can be sensitive and may require service down the line. A well-supported brand can save headaches if issues arise after your purchase.
Frequently Asked Questions
Is it worth paying extra for a higher refresh rate on an OLED TV?
Higher refresh rates, like 120Hz, are beneficial if you watch a lot of fast-paced content such as sports or gaming. They provide smoother motion and reduce blur, enhancing action scenes. However, most OLED TVs are optimized for movies and TV shows at 60Hz, and the difference may not justify a higher price unless gaming is a priority. Consider your primary usage to decide if the added cost is worthwhile for your setup.
Should I prioritize HDR support or overall picture quality?
HDR support, especially Dolby Vision, can dramatically improve the visual experience by revealing more detail in bright and dark scenes. However, HDR performance also depends on peak brightness and local dimming capabilities. For OLEDs, picture quality usually surpasses LCDs in contrast, but ensure the model supports your preferred HDR formats. Balancing HDR features with overall picture quality will give you the most satisfying viewing experience.
Are larger OLED TVs worth it if I have limited space?
Larger OLEDs provide a more immersive experience but require adequate space for optimal viewing. If your room size or furniture placement limits viewing distance, a smaller model might deliver better visual comfort. Measure your space carefully, and remember that sitting too close to a large screen can diminish image clarity. Prioritize size based on your room dimensions rather than just the price or features.
Can I trust Black Friday discounts on OLED TVs to be genuine?
Black Friday often features significant discounts, but it’s important to verify the deal’s authenticity. Compare the sale price to the model’s typical retail pricing and check for any additional fees or limited-time offers. Sometimes, discounts are available year-round, so look for bundles or added warranties that increase overall value. Being a savvy shopper means doing a bit of research to ensure the deal is truly advantageous.
Is it better to buy a new model or a last year’s model during Black Friday?
Buying a last year’s model can be a smart way to save money while still getting excellent performance, especially if the new model doesn’t offer significant upgrades. However, newer models often include improved processing, better HDR performance, and extended support. Consider whether the features you value most are present in the previous generation, and weigh the savings against potential future-proofing benefits of the latest models.
